Sarah Hayley Orrantia

Sarah Hayley Orrantia was born February 21, 1994. She is an American singer and actress. She is famous for her role as Erica Goldberg on the ABC comedy show The Goldbergs. She was a member of Lakoda Rayne, a country pop girl group assembled by Paula Abdul during the first season of The X Factor. The singer released her debut track "Love Sick" in the year 2015. Her debut EP, The Way Out, was released in May 2019. Orrantia wrote the song "Who I Am" for the National Eating Disorders Association and the track "Power of A Girl" for the Girl Scouts of the USA. She also helps the cancer-related charity Lungevity, Susan G. Komen, and Stand Up to Cancer.  Since 2007 she has served as an ambassador for the Texas Music Project, which is a fund-raising initiative that raises awareness and funds to support music education in public schools. Sarah Hayley Orrantia, a Texas native was born in Arlington on February 22, 1994. She was raised in Highland Village, Texas.
